Our PR Team had a few tidbits to share:

FUNimation had three new Websites launch today. The official sites for Solty Rei (www.soltyrei.tv), Rumbling Hearts (www.rumblinghearts.com) and Full Metal Panic: The Second Raid (www.fullmetalpanictsr.com) went live this morning. The first episode of Rumbling Hearts is available on the new site and if you haven't had a chance to see Full Metal Panic Episode 000, it is available at www.fullmetalpanictsr.com.

We also introduced some new programming to our FUNimation Channel today. Revolutionary Girl Utena debuted today on the FUNimation Channel. The series will run at 8:30 a.m., 3:00 p.m. and 11:00 p.m. ET. Woot! Go Channel! Razz

I'm really glad that Funimation is grabbing up all of the Gonzo titles. Geneon has done an okay job with there Gonzo releases, but lack the alternate angle OP/ED and 5.1 English remix.

I find it funny that Tasha Robinson from scifi.com had a recent review on Moonphase which mentions that they had never seen this angle feature before, even though she has been reviewing FUnimation titles since before Blue Gender!


"This disc has a feature I've never seen before: It lets you use the "angle" button on your remote to toggle the opening and closing credits between Japanese and English. Very nifty! Though it isn't much of an extra, and neither are the spare trailers/textless credit sequences that comprise the disc's only special features. —Tasha"

That is correct ADV did the recordings for the Voice Talent.
As for Utena and Rumbling Hearts on the COLours Block, Currently these are scheduled for the FUNimation Channel. We have received some great feedback for these shows and are working on these properties as well as aquiring other properties to broadcast. I'll do some more digging on whether we'll get some of these programs on the COLours block and get back to you guys with an update.

For Tsubasa: It's still either Spring-Summer 2007. We don't have a definite date yet, it all depends on production. However I do know recording has begun! I can't wait for this one either I love Tsubasa (I'm a fan of most CLAMP titles).

For School Rumble: I know it's 2007 but no date or estimate yet
